Phi Sigma Tau is the International Honor Society in Philosophy and is a member of the Association of College Honor Societies. The Arkansas Beta Chapter’s Mission at the University of Arkansas at Little Rock is Five-Fold:

  1. to recognize and award distinction to students who display great interest and achieve scholarship in philosophy
  2. to promote student interest in research and advanced study in philosophy
  3. to provide opportunities for the publication of student research papers of merit
  4. to encourage and facilitate the professional spirit and friendship between exceptional students of philosophy
  5. to popularize interest in philosophy among the general collegiate public

Membership

General Membership Requirements

Undergraduate students at UA Little Rock are eligible for active membership in Phi Sigma Tau if they meet the following criteria:

  1. Completion of a minimum of 24 hours of college coursework
  2. Completion of two 3-hour courses in philosophy with an average GPA greater than 3.0 in those courses
  3. Overall GPA greater than 3.0

Students wishing to be members of Phi Sigma Tau must fill out a directory card and pay a one-time initiation fee (currently $25) to the national office.  Submit your directory card and check to the Faculty Advisor, Dr. Michael Norton.
